{ "name": "kevink.dev", "version": "1.1.0", "private": true, "description": "KevinK.dev", "author": "Kevin Kandlbinder", "keywords": [ "gatsby" ], "scripts": { "develop": "gatsby develop", "start": "gatsby develop", "build": "gatsby build", "prettier": "npx prettier --write .", "serve": "gatsby serve", "clean": "gatsby clean", "prepare": "husky install", "tscss": "typed-scss-modules src --watch" }, "license": "Apache-2.0", "dependencies": { "@babel/cli": "7.19.3", "@babel/plugin-transform-typescript": "7.20.2", "@fontsource/encode-sans": "4.5.9", "@icons-pack/react-simple-icons": "6.1.0", "@mdx-js/mdx": "1.6.22", "@mdx-js/react": "1.6.22", "@react-hook/media-query": "1.1.1", "@types/animejs": "3.1.6", "@types/node": "18.11.9", "@types/react": "18.0.25", "@types/react-dom": "18.0.9", "animejs": "3.2.1", "babel-plugin-i18next-extract": "0.8.3", "gatsby": "4.24.8", "gatsby-awesome-pagination": "0.3.8", "gatsby-cli": "4.24.0", "gatsby-plugin-asset-path": "3.0.4", "gatsby-plugin-feed": "4.24.0", "gatsby-plugin-image": "2.24.0", "gatsby-plugin-manifest": "4.24.0", "gatsby-plugin-mdx": "3.20.0", "gatsby-plugin-netlify": "5.0.1", "gatsby-plugin-offline": "5.24.0", "gatsby-plugin-portal": "1.0.7", "gatsby-plugin-react-helmet": "5.24.0", "gatsby-plugin-react-i18next": "2.0.5", "gatsby-plugin-remote-images": "3.5.0", "gatsby-plugin-remove-serviceworker": "1.0.0", "gatsby-plugin-robots-txt": "1.8.0", "gatsby-plugin-sass": "5.24.0", "gatsby-plugin-sharp": "4.24.0", "gatsby-plugin-sitemap": "5.24.0", "gatsby-plugin-typescript": "4.24.0", "gatsby-remark-copy-linked-files": "5.24.0", "gatsby-remark-images": "6.24.0", "gatsby-source-filesystem": "4.24.0", "gatsby-transformer-json": "4.24.0", "gatsby-transformer-sharp": "4.24.0", "hamburger-react": "2.5.0", "i18next": "22.0.5", "locale": "0.1.0", "lodash": "4.17.21", "lucide-react": "0.101.0", "prop-types": "15.8.1", "react": "18.2.0", "react-dom": "18.2.0", "react-github-btn": "1.4.0", "react-helmet": "6.1.0", "react-i18next": "12.0.0", "sass": "1.56.1", "tsparticles": "2.5.3", "typed-scss-modules": "7.0.1", "utterances-react": "0.1.3" }, "devDependencies": { "babel-eslint": "10.1.0", "eslint": "7.32.0", "eslint-loader": "4.0.2", "eslint-plugin-import": "2.26.0", "eslint-plugin-react": "7.31.10", "gatsby-plugin-eslint": "4.0.3", "husky": "8.0.2", "lint-staged": "13.0.3", "prettier": "2.7.1" }, "lint-staged": { "*.js": "eslint --cache --fix", "*.{js,css,md,scss,json,tsx,ts}": "prettier --write" } }